Adjustable Wrench

 

Designed to have a firm grip, an adjustable wrench is an essential tool because it has been perfectly designed to be an ideal match for plumbing parts that are hexagonal and have similarly shaped nuts. As per expert plumber in Fort Worth, TX it is great for using on supply lines, compression fittings, and other repairs. Two sizes are available of this tool; six inches and a ten-inch wrench.

 

Pipe Wrench

 

Heavier than an adjustable wrench, a pipe wrench is also used for the purpose of tightening and loosening fittings and nuts. To deal with an issue in the plumbing you generally require the use of two pipe wrenches so that one can be used to hold and other can be used for turning. One recommendation made by the plumber in Fort Worth, TX to everyone to avoid any sort of damage to the finishing of your fixture is to make sure that you wrap the wrench’s jaw in cloth.

 

Basin Wrench

 

A basin wrench looks like an apparatus with a clamp-like end because it has a long shaft and a swivel. Because of this design, it can easily reach deep, narrow spaces behind the sinks and is commonly used to loosen and tighten nuts and bolts on sink faucets. It is a necessary staple that should be in your toolbox.

 

Metal File

 

When you cut a pipe or any surface it tends to become rough from that place from where it has been cut. This could be dangerous as anyone could get hurt and also it would create an issue when you try to fix some other pipe to this place. Therefore a metal file is necessary and although there are different sizes available at retail stores and shops, the plumber in Fort Worth, TX suggests you have these two always in your plumbing box; a rat-tail file which is round and tapered, and a half-round file which has rounded and flat surfaces.

 

Thread Seal Tape

 

To help prevent leaks at joint connections that are threaded a thread seal tape also referred to as the plumber’s tape or PTFE tape, is the right thing to use. It can be used on a variety of plumbing projects like on the water line connections or the shower heads.
